Ty France’s one-out, two-run walk-off home run against Lucas Erceg in the ninth inning gave the Twins a 3-1 win against the Royals at Target Field on Friday.
Carlos Correa and Ty France had the only meaningful hits for the Twins on a night when the pitching staff allowed only one run.
